A beautiful mind : the life of mathematical genius and Nobel Laureate John Nash / Sylvia Nasar.
The true story of John Nash, the math genius who was a legend by age thirty when he slipped into madness; through the selflessness of a beautiful woman and the loyalty of the mathematics community he emerged after decades of ghostlike existence to win a Nobel Prize; now a major motion picture--Cover.
